California SB1396 amends Section 374.3 of the Penal Code to increase fines for illegal dumping. It mandates fines of not less than $250 and up to $1,000 for a first conviction, $500 to $1,500 for a second conviction, and $750 to $3,000 for a third or subsequent conviction. If the dumped waste includes used tires, the fines are doubled. The bill also introduces mandatory fines for commercial quantities of dumped waste, ranging from $1,000 to $3,000 for a first conviction, $3,000 to $6,000 for a second conviction, and $6,000 to $20,000 for a third or subsequent conviction.
